Baldock Train Station comes with essential amenities to make your journey smooth and comfortable. It has a ticket office operational from early in the morning until early afternoon on weekdays and Saturdays, although it is not open on Sundays. For those who prefer pre-booking tickets online, ticket collection is available through accessible ticket machines designed to cater for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ts too.
There are help points scattered across the station for timely assistance, although note that staff are available only during certain hours. Be mindful that the station lacks step-free access, which might be a point to consider for anyone with mobility restrictions. Unfortunately, there are no waiting rooms, refreshments, or luggage storage facilities, so planning ahead is crucial. On the flip side, the station is secured with CCTV for added safety.

Greenock West station operates an extensive schedule to cater to all your ticketing needs, with the ticket office open from 06:00 in the morning until just past midnight. For those catching an early or late train, ticket machines are readily available, including options that cater to individuals requiring accessible services. If you have already booked your journey online, collecting your tickets at the station is made easy with the smartcard technology integrated into the ticket machines.
Support and assistance are a priority at Greenock West. Staff are on hand to help from 06:00 to 00:05, ensuring a worry-free journey for all passengers. For those with mobility challenges, it is important to note that the station is categorized as 'Level C,' with no step-free access. However, the station offers an induction loop and several helpful customer information points. Feel the assurance of security as you travel, with CCTV planted strategically around the station.
For those looking for onward travel options, Greenock West has well-laid transport links. Whether you’re planning to take a quick bus ride or need a taxi, the station's transport network dovetails seamlessly into the broader public transportation system. Rail replacement services and local buses can be accessed right outside West College on Nelson Street. For more bespoke transport needs, taxi services details are conveniently available at www.traintaxi.co.uk.
Whether catching a bus, taxi, or looking into car hire, you are assured of straightforward connections. Notably, for regular commuters and travelers, free car parking operated by the local council is available nearby, with a total of 100 parking spaces.
